Richard Henderson 6cb2b9646d arm: Use arm_cmpdi_unsigned for thumb2 as well
This changes code generation from "eors; eors; orrs" (which ranges
from 6 to 12 bytes and requires three scratch registers), to
"cmp; it; cmp" (which is always 6 bytes for register inputs and
requires no scratch registers).

        * config/arm/arm.md (*arm_cmpdi_unsigned): Enable for thumb2.
        * config/arm/arm.c (arm_select_cc_mode): Use it.
